on my 84 t3... sometimes, the float bowl likes to over flow....it was perfect until i wrecked my streetbike, and now after the road rash healed, i put gas in it... now it likes to over flow... sometimes... sometimes it wont, but sometimes it will....

its strange, i pulled the carb, made sure the floats arent stuck, cleaned the needle valve.... but still, sometimes it'll overflow... and keep overflowing until i shut the fuel valve off... and sometimes, it'll be fine... this bothers the crap outta me, anything got a solution ?

My Tecate used to do the same thing until I bought a needle and seat on Ebay.$7.95 and works great.The guy I got it from is in New Zealand and calls it a float valve on Ebay. In fact I think he has one listed right now.Good luck!! :Bounce
